Our paper is out! Work by Christopher Black in collaboration with Liam Browne, Rob Brownstone, and Marco Beato. Here, we describe the unique kinematic signatures of multi-limb coordination in freely climbing mice and show how these flexibly adapt to changing environments. tinyurl.com/4bnw88wk
Naturalistic climbing reveals adaptive strategies for interlimb coordination in freely moving mice
Multi-limb coordination is vital for mammalian locomotion. While coordination requires reliable organization of limb movements, it also requires flexibility to adapt to environmental demands. In natur...

I don’t know if you saw the MASSIVE news announced by @erc.europa.eu today: from now on, if you get a B at step 1 you are eligible to apply at N+3(!!!) years. Say you got a B in STG2026 step 1, you thought you could apply in STG2028, but no: only in STG2029! erc.europa.eu/news-events/...
Applying for an ERC grant in the 2027 competitions: what you need to know
The ERC plans to launch the grant competitions under its 2027 Work Programme between July 2026 and June 2027, with the calls for proposals introducing several changes to the eligibility rules for appl...

MRC curiosity-driven research reopens with new approach www.ukri.org/news/mrc-cur... MRC applicant-led funding opportunities reopen 7 Apr, experimental medicine opportunities opening 30 Apr Complete change in selection of project: no boards, shortlisted applicants -> in-person panel interview.

New preprint from the lab on synapse development in the nascent neocortical hierarchy! Using mice that label MAGUK proteins developed by Seth Grant we find key differences in the laminar maturation of association and sensory motor cortices, including delayed, cortex-wide maturation of L1 synapses.
